Waste-to-Energy Technologies



With waste generation on the rise, locating lasting remedies is becoming increasingly important. Waste-to-Energy (WtE) technologies offer an encouraging method to handling our waste while creating energy. These technologies entail converting non-recyclable waste materials into functional kinds of power like electricity, heat, or gas.



By drawing away waste from garbage dumps and blazing it in controlled settings, WtE not just reduces the quantity of waste but also generates important energy resources.

One common approach of WtE is mass-burn incineration, where waste is burned at heats to create vapor that drives turbines creating electrical power. An additional method is gasification, which transforms waste right into artificial gas that can be utilized for power generation or as a chemical feedstock.

Furthermore, anaerobic digestion breaks down organic waste to generate biogas for power.

Carrying out WtE modern technologies can help in reducing greenhouse gas emissions, reduce dependence on nonrenewable fuel sources, and decrease the ecological effect of waste disposal.
